The Kybalion: Hermetic Philosophy by the Three Initiates is a classic work of esoteric philosophy that distills the ancient wisdom of Hermeticism into seven core principles: Mentalism: The universe is mental, and all phenomena are manifestations of Mind.Correspondence: As above, so below; as within, so without.Vibration: Everything vibrates at its own unique frequency, and the differences between different things are due to their differing rates of vibration.Polarity: Everything has its opposite, and these opposites are complementary and interdependent.Rhythm: Everything flows in cycles of alternating manifestation and withdrawal.Cause and Effect: Every effect has a cause, and every cause has an effect.Gender: Everything has both masculine and feminine aspects, and these aspects are in dynamic interplay.The Kybalion is a concise and elegant work that offers a profound understanding of the underlying principles of reality.
